When connecting this unit to a device that is compatible with the Deep Color, 4K, ARC and eARC functions, use a “High Speed HDMI cable with Ethernet" that displays the HDMI logo.

When connecting this unit to a device that is compatible with 8K and 4K 120Hz video, use a certified “Ultra High Speed HDMI cable". If you use a different HDMI cable, the video may not display or other problems may occur.

Setup

1. Connect the antennas

1) Place the antenna evenly over the antenna terminal located at the upper left or right corner of the rear panel.

2) Turn the antenna clockwise until it is fully connected. Do not over tighten.

3) Rotate the antenna upwards for the best possible reception.

Illustration showing an antenna being screwed into a terminal, then rotated clockwise, and finally rotated upwards.

The antennas are required for both Bluetooth and Wi-Fi functions.

Optional: Network Connection

If you are connecting the AVR to a wired network, connect an Ethernet cable (not included) between the AVR and your router. Do not connect the Ethernet cable if you are connecting the AVR to a wireless network.

3. Connect the AVR to your TV

Using a high quality HDMI cable*, connect one end to the HDMI port labeled "eARC" or "ARC" on your TV. Connect the other end to the HDMI OUT MONITOR 1 port on your AVR.

Diagram showing an HDMI cable connecting the TV's HDMI OUT (ARC) port to the AVR's HDMI OUT MONITOR 1 port.

What is ARC and eARC?

Audio Return Channel or "ARC" sends audio back to the AVR using the same HDMI cable that sends video from your AVR to your TV. This allows your AVR to process the sound from your TV's built-in tuner and apps. TVs with an Enhanced Audio Return Channel or "eARC" port provide additional support for high bitrate multichannel audio (Dolby Atmos, Dolby TrueHD, DTS-HD and DTS:X). Please refer to your TV owner's manual for details about eARC support for your particular model.

* For 4K TVs, we recommend using an HDMI cable labeled "High Speed" and "with Ethernet".

* For 8K TVs, we recommend using an HDMI cable labeled "Ultra High Speed”.

8. Verify the connection

Verify that you can see the "AV Receiver Setup Assistant" screen on your TV.

Screenshot of the 'AV Receiver Setup Assistant' screen on a TV, showing language selection options.

If this screen is not displayed, please go back and retry the steps again in the recommended sequence.

In case the unit was already set up previously, the Setup Assistant may not start automatically, and you might only see the Marantz logo on screen. In such cases, you can access the Setup Assistant by pressing SETUP on the remote control and selecting Setup Assistant from the menu.
